Kukuda Mission Primary School is located in Kukuda Basti, Bast Ward No 6, Kukuda, Rajgangpur, Sundargarh, Odisha and was established 86 years ago. This school is a Co-educational and is located in Rural area. This is a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Government Aided. The school is situated in 13-Rajgangpur(St) assembly constituency. The school is located in Sundargarh parliamentary constituency. The first mode of communication is Odia in the school.

The school has strength of around one hundred students and has recruited total 3 teachers. The school has student-teacher ratio of 32 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. All of the teachers are Female. In terms of Academic qualification two teachers are Below Graduate and rest one is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 19:1, means on an average nineteen students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 95 students in class I to V.

The school is in a Govt. building and it has no boundary walls. The school has total five clasrooms. There is reading corner, library and book bank for students. There are one boys toilet and one girls toilet for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
